Formatage nombres à virgule flottante: informations manquantes

Pour toutes les discussions javascript, jQuery et autres frameworks
Répondre
cacaproutfirst
Messages : 2
Enregistré le : 21 avr. 2022, 15:07

Formatage nombres à virgule flottante: informations manquantes

Message par cacaproutfirst » 21 avr. 2022, 15:14

Bonjour,

A la page 79, il est écrit que les nombres du type 2.9999999999999 au lieu de 3 peuvent être corrigés à la page 83. Mais je ne comprends pas comment utiliser « intl » pour fair cela. Pourrait t-on m’expliquer comment on fait?

Merci

Avatar du membre
webmaster
Administrateur du site
Messages : 563
Enregistré le : 28 févr. 2017, 15:19

Re: Formatage nombres à virgule flottante: informations manquantes

Message par webmaster » 21 avr. 2022, 15:47

Bonjour,

Il y a un exemple sur la fiche de Intl du site
https://www.toutjavascript.com/referenc ... format.php

J'ai ajouté l'exemple 2,9999 en fin de script
TJS : 25 ans et mon livre Tout JavaScript chez Dunod
https://www.toutjavascript.com/livre/index.php

cacaproutfirst
Messages : 2
Enregistré le : 21 avr. 2022, 15:07

Re: Formatage nombres à virgule flottante: informations manquantes

Message par cacaproutfirst » 25 avr. 2022, 21:32

Bonjour,
J’ai mal formulé ma question. Je voulais juste une autre technique car si on met un nombre de décimales fixé, on arrondi, donc le résultat n’est pas précis. Y a t-il une autre technique?
Merci

Avatar du membre
webmaster
Administrateur du site
Messages : 563
Enregistré le : 28 févr. 2017, 15:19

Re: Formatage nombres à virgule flottante: informations manquantes

Message par webmaster » 26 avr. 2022, 09:07

Il y a Math.round qui arrondit a l'entier
La fiche ici donne une astuce pour arrondir à X décimales
https://www.toutjavascript.com/referenc ... .round.php
TJS : 25 ans et mon livre Tout JavaScript chez Dunod
https://www.toutjavascript.com/livre/index.php

Répondre